peter> I have a Promise UDMA100 controller, and cooker's installer sees my three
peter> drives as hd{e,f,g} but the installed kernel sees them as hd{a,b,c}, so lilo
peter> doesn't work for me at install time. Prior to cooker upgrade I have to alter
peter> fstab to hd{e,f,g}, then do the hd upgrade, skip lilo, boot into 8.0, chroot
peter> /cooker, change fstab back, run lilo - then I can boot cooker sucessfully.
peter> I haven't yet tried rerunning lilo from cooker, but I suspect your problem is
peter> caused by cooker's lilo rather than the kernel.
hum, that is not happening here at all. Could you check that you have
activated in the BIOS your primary & secondary IDE channels?
I can achieve that behaviour here if I turn off in the BIOS the IDE
support, but not of other way :(((
If that don't work either, please boot with the boot param (in the
lilo line) ide=reverse, and told me if that works.
